The fixing side support unit is equipped with preload-adjusted JIS5 class angular bearings.
The internal bearings of EK, FK, and BK type support units are filled with an appropriate amount of lithium-soap-based grease and sealed with a special seal,
enabling long-term use.

(1) Be careful to prevent the entry of contaminants such as cutting chips or coolant. Otherwise, it may cause damage.
(2) If the product is used in environments where cutting chip, coolant, corrosive solvents, water, etc. may enter the interior, avoid entry into the product by using bellows, cover, or similar protection.
(3) Avoid using the product at temperatures exceeding 80°C. Except for heat resistant specifications, if this temperature is exceeded, resin and rubber parts may be deformed or damaged.
(4) If cutting chip or other contaminant adheres to the product, please clean it and then reapply lubricant.
(5) In cases of slight oscillation, it is difficult for an oil film to form on the contact surfaces between the rolling element and the rolling surface, which may cause fretting. Please use grease with excellent fretting resistance. In addition, we recommend periodically performing an operation equivalent to one rotation of the ball screw nut to form an oil film on the rolling surfaces and rolling elements.
(6) Do not forcibly drive positioning components (such as pins or keys) into the product. This may cause indentations on the rolling surfaces and result in loss of function.
(7) If there is any misalignment or tilting between the ball screw shaft support and the ball screw nut, the lifespan may become extremely short. Please pay close attention to the mounting components and assembly accuracy.
(8) If the rolling element falls out of the ball screw nut, do not use it as is.
(9) When using in a vertical axis, please take measures such as adding a safety mechanism to prevent falling. The ball screw nut may fall by its own weight.
(10) Do not use the product in excess of the allowable rotational speed. May lead to damage to parts or accidents. Please use within MISUMI's specified rotating speed range.
(11) Do not let a ball screw nut overrun. This may cause balls to fall out, damage to circulation components, or indentations on the ball rolling surface, resulting in malfunction. In addition, continued use in this condition may lead to premature wear or damage to circulation components.
(12) When using the ball screw, please provide guide elements such as an LM guide or ball spline. It may cause damage.
(13) If the rigidity or accuracy of the mounting component is insufficient, the load on the bearing will be locally concentrated, and the bearing performance will be significantly reduced. Therefore, please thoroughly consider the rigidity and accuracy of the housing and base, as well as the strength of the fixing bolts.
(1) Wipe off the anti-rust oil thoroughly and fill with lubricant before use.
(2) Avoid mixing different lubricants. Even if the thickener is the same type of grease, differences in additives and other components may have adverse effects on each other.
(3) When used in special environments such as locations subject to constant vibration, clean rooms, vacuum, or extreme low or high temperatures, please use grease suitable for the specifications and environment.
(4) When lubricating products that do not have a grease fitting or oil hole, apply lubricant directly to the rolling surface and perform several break-in strokes to ensure grease enters the interior.
(5) The consistency of the grease changes depending on the temperature. Please note that changes in consistency will also affect the torque of the ball screw.
(6) After lubrication, the mixing resistance of the grease may cause the rotational torque of the ball screw to increase. Be sure to perform a break-in operation and allow the grease to fully blend in before operating the machine.
(7) Immediately after greasing, excess grease may scatter around the area, so please wipe it off as needed before use.
(8) The properties of grease deteriorate and its lubrication performance declines over time, so it is necessary to inspect and replenish the grease according to usage frequency.
(9) The lubrication interval may vary depending on the usage conditions and operating environment, but as a reference, please lubricate every 100 km of travel (every 3 to 6 months). Please determine the final lubrication interval and amount based on actual machine operation.
(10) Depending on the mounting orientation and the lubrication port of the nut, the lubricant may not circulate properly, resulting in insufficient lubrication. Please consider this carefully during the design stage.
(11) When using a ball screw, it is necessary to ensure proper lubrication. If used without lubrication, wear on the rolling parts may increase and cause premature lifespan reduction.
Store ball screws in MISUMI's packaging and shipping configuration, avoiding high temperatures, low temperatures, and high humidity, and keep them in a horizontal position indoors.
For products stored for a long period, the internal lubricant may have deteriorated over time, so please replenish the lubricant before use.
